COMPANY BUSINESS (INCLUDING MAIN COUNTRY OF OPERATION) OR, IN THE CASE OF AN INVESTING COMPANY, DETAILS OF ITS INVESTING POLICY). IF THE ADMISSION IS SOUGHT AS A RESULT OF A REVERSE TAKE-OVER UNDER RULE 14, THIS SHOULD BE STATED: |
||||||||||||
|
Optima Health is the UK's leading provider by size of technology enabled corporate health and wellbeing solutions. The Group aims to empower organisations to bring out the best in their people, and themselves, by actively managing their health and wellbeing, and supports workplace wellbeing with digitally connected health solutions. Underpinned by a robust clinical governance framework, the Group leverages its proprietary technology and flexible delivery model to foster healthy high performance.
The Group's main country of operation is the UK.
